xpcc-swd

This is a port of scanlime's swd code for the esp8266 to xpcc.

test setup

To test this code you need a stm32f3 discovery board which serves as SWD host. Just go into stm32f3discovery and execute scons program to flash the test firmware. UART output is on GpioA2 @ 115200 baud.

connect swd target

As target board I used a stm32f4 discovery board, but the swd code should

  • in general - work with any microcontroller that features a swd debug port.

For the stm32f4 discovery board you need to do the following:

  • remove the two jumper close to ST-Link/DISCOVERY print to disconnect SWD from the on board ST-Link debug adapter
  • connect groud: GDN(stm32f3) to GND(stm32f4)
  • connect swd clock: PC6(stm32f3) to PA14(stm32f4)
  • connect swd data: PC7(stm32f3) to PA13(stm32f4)

Now you should be able to reset the stm32f3 swd host and see the following printed through the UART interface:

Found ARM processor debug port (IDCODE: 2BA01477)
